Output 3c23913826e8ca390be9188a72869a41e43dbc8c97948352009627ced45565ba:0

value
187706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6966a02a08ffa83e9952446472c9e0bcc9130ab OP_EQUAL
address
3MFeiYtETvGC7EMBnrE9cTBPEn8st8GQpD
transaction
3c23913826e8ca390be9188a72869a41e43dbc8c97948352009627ced45565ba
confirmations
107850
spent
true